This pull request seeks to allow the user to preview changes to a published post without first updating the post (i.e. the autosave revision preview).

In doing so, it...

To the latter point, I landed at the conclusion that preview_link only makes sense in the context of autsosaves on consideration of:

  • The post endpoints reflect the value of the canonical saved post. If there are no unsaved changes, the user should be directed to post.link as its preview.
  • It does not belong in the revisions endpoints because it is not the case that any revision can be previewed. A preview only occurs for the latest revision of a post (_set_preview, wp_get_post_autosave).

Related Trac tickets:

Thus, if there are no unsaved changes for a post, the Preview button is effectively a link to post.link. If there are unsaved changes, the autosave is triggered and once its responses' autosave.preview_link becomes accessible, it is used in the redirect (regardless of whether or not the autosave occurred as a full save as described in #7124).

Couple small nits. I also ran into an issue where the preview doesn't reflect the title:

I can reproduce this, and it seems to affect where we're previewing a post we'd already previewed once before in the same session:

  1. Navigate to Posts > Add New
  2. Enter a title
  3. Hit preview
  4. Return to editor tab
  5. Change title
  6. Hit preview

Expected: Preview is shown with updated title
Actual: Preview reflects original title.

The problem is that the second time we preview, we already have a preview_link available because we reset the autosave after the first preview. I think we either need to:

  • Clear the preview_link before an autosave starts so it isn't considered for the popup window
  • Consider change detection and invalidate the preview link as soon as the user makes an edit
  • Force the autosave and interstitial screen if the post is dirty, even if a preview link is already available
    • Might be the simplest approach for now. Technically this is wasted for repeatedly hitting "Preview" on a published post, since it remains dirty after an autosave.
    • Effectively a revert of 7658b07
